Guest guest Posted April 18, 2008 Report Share Posted April 18, 2008 Peach Cardamom Scones 2 cups unbleached all-purpose flour 1/2 tsp. salt 1/4 cup granulated sugar 1 tsp. cardamom 1 tbsp. baking powder 6 tbsps. cold butter, cut into pieces 2 eggs, beaten 1/3 cup vanilla yogurt 1/2 tsp. almond extract 1 cup diced peaches 2 tbsps. melted butter 2 tbsps. granulated sugar Preheat the oven to 375 degrees. Sift flour, salt, sugar, cardamom and baking powder into a bowl. Add the butter and rub into the flour until the mixture looks like breadcrumbs. Beat the two eggs, yogurt and almond extract together. Pour into the dry ingredients. Mix until just incorporated. Gently fold the peach pieces into the mix. Knead gently on a floured board. Roll out until 1/2 " thick. Using a biscuit cutter, or shape into 8 rounds or triangles. Place on a baking sheet, and brush with the melted butter. Sprinkle with sugar. Bake for 20 minutes, until lightly browned and to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ool on a wire rack. Serve warm. Yields 8 scones.
